The past week seemed to have flown by in a single day. Accustomed to monotonous, hard work throughout his life, Seliad didn't pay much attention to the hardships of the job; he was much more concerned about the tasks assigned by the administration.
He wasn't too worried about being rejected; rather, he would see it as a certain relief and a sign from above. But on the other hand, even fully aware of the increased risks, he wanted to end his life this way rather than languish in the factory until old age. Ultimately, his father died in battle, fighting for the good of his homeland, and the Darkian himself couldn't have dreamed of anything more. However, in recent years, his opinion of military service had changed significantly for the worse, but in the Empire, one could always find a way to be useful. Moreover, he was genuinely interested in the palace from a historical point of view; he had read a lot about its ruler, and such good fortune could add new emotions to his monotonous life.
Subconsciously, he also hoped that, in case of success, he would have enough money for some kind of life, not in a big city, but in a rural backwater. Or maybe, on the expedition, he would find friends with whom he could travel to the ends of the earth. In any case, almost any outcome, whether negative or positive, would be quite acceptable for Seliad, which meant that the venture looked quite promising.
Having collected his last paycheck, the Darkian confidently headed towards Regalis. There, though not without regret, he sold his old armor and acquired brand new Alivarian armor. (895+200-1000=95). To celebrate the pleasant event of updating his inventory, he decided to go to a bar, where he bought a Starfall (95-20=75).
Sitting at a table, he recalled his first visit to this place, a week ago, and the strange philosophical conversation with three strangers. For some reason, this insignificant event was clearly imprinted in his memory.
To drive away the heavy thoughts, Seliad headed to the arcade machine and made five attempts, hoping for luck (75-5x5=50). The remaining money should be enough for the last night before a possible departure.

The day before his possible departure south, Halmeldir spent in the bar, which he had already grown accustomed to. He was a little nervous, as the journey ahead was long and to lands he had never seen. But this option appealed to him more than returning to the northern lands and wandering through the wilderness, although he would undoubtedly excel at that. The old palace also held little appeal, despite its great fame and the rumors surrounding it. But the elf believed that it was just an old palace, full of dust, and the only inhabitants were perhaps some mold, or birds that flew in through the windows and built nests somewhere on the roof. In any case, he didn't really want to wander around the ancient building and rummage through the imperial belongings.
Sitting in the bar, Halmeldir thought about the journey and watched the visitors, including some soldier who repeatedly tried his luck at the arcade machine. The elf wondered if anyone had ever actually won at this machine, but that thought quickly faded from his mind when it was time to go to the administration building.
